KTM 390 SMC R Specifications: A Pocket Rocket on Steroids

The KTM 390 SMC R specifications truly set it apart in the under-500cc category. Here are some highlights:

  • Engine: 373cc, single-cylinder, liquid-cooled
  • Max Power: 44 HP @ 9,000 rpm
  • Max Torque: 37 Nm @ 7,000 rpm
  • Gearbox: 6-speed with quickshifter+
  • Frame: Steel trellis frame (lightweight and strong)
  • Brakes: 320mm front and 230mm rear with Bosch cornering ABS
  • Suspension: Fully adjustable WP APEX front and rear
  • Weight: 150 kg (dry)
  • Fuel Tank: 9.5 liters

These specs translate to razor-sharp handling, quick take-offs, and superb control over twisties and city traffic alike.

KTM 390 SMC R Price & Mileage in India

KTM 390 SMC R

Let’s talk numbers.

  • KTM 390 SMC R price in India (Expected): ₹3.30 – ₹3.50 lakh (ex-showroom)
  • On-road price (Metro Cities): ₹3.90 – ₹4.10 lakh
  • Mileage: Around 27–30 km/l, which is decent for a bike with this much punch.

While it’s pricier than most 390cc bikes, you’re getting top-tier hardware and unmatched style. Plus, considering KTM’s service network in India, maintenance won’t break your wallet.

KTM 390 SMC R Pros and Cons

Let’s break it down:

Pros:

  • Best-in-class performance
  • Lightweight and agile
  • Advanced electronics (cornering ABS, TFT display)
  • Unique Supermoto design
  • Great brand presence & service support

Cons:

  • High seat height (not ideal for shorter riders)
  • Small fuel tank
  • Not ideal for long-distance touring
  • Slightly overpriced compared to naked 390
